Isabella Kuhl: I’ll start by saying the ambiance was fantastic. It felt link an intimate dinner party despite being a fairly well sized restaurant. They have a real fireplace that someone came around to stoke. The wait staff was super friendly and attentive and the drinks were fantastic. As for the food, it was mediocre enough that here I am trying to dissuade others from wasting their money. You could tell everything was made with fancy, fresh ingredients but the flavor combinations just didn’t work. It tasted like the owner wanted to justify the $75 per person price tag by just putting together anything expensive they could find. We tried the crudo, kale dish, lumache, venison, short rib, and affogato. A lot of dishes had Asian influences but it honestly just didn’t work. The flavor combinations were so off - we picked apart basically every dish because individually the ingredients were fresh and unique but together it was bizarre and unflattering. I wasn’t amazed with anything; even the affogato (just ice cream and espresso) was mediocre. The ice cream was bland and the espresso was watery. We had a hard time getting through all the dishes both because it was a solid amount of food but mostly because we didn’t want to finish. If you’re curious and have $75 per person to blow, then give it a shot. Otherwise, if you want a fine dining experience that has tasty food that you’ll want to finish every bite, try Uni.
